    Some cracking stuff over the years.

    Remember cutting my teeth on Win-A-Gain, Nudge Bug, Firecracker had an awesome double/nothing gamble which if it potted then the JP could hold several times.

    Emptiers/Manipulators aside, the game play and profit was great.

    Teenage years – Money Trapper / Screen Play / Big Shot all great games.

    Student years it was Project mania – 7 Heavens, hi tecs like Last Orders / Chico The Bandit / The Warden. An early computer screen one called Dungeon Master – then full blown CG with Reno Reels / Sunburst / Monte Carlo etc.

    I swear the the only reason I came out of my student years with no overdraft was down to the fruits.

    Then machines starting turning worse – the golden era of JPM’S came and went – Ace coin was no longer and BFM rained supreme with the DOND brand. We all became great box readers and COB pot chasers.

    Then you get towards today and rigged boxes / heavily controlled percentages and flat profiles. I still play pub and Hi Tec but a lot of my playing is now Lo Tec £100 JP’s where knowing their cycles and history is key to making money.

    The best feeling was having a day when your token pocket never ran out and wisely taking cash out of machines before replenishing tokens meant and ever growing profit in the cash pocket.
